Oracle 8 does have some benefits over 7.x versions. Version 8 has a
better optimizer so your queries should(?) run faster. The database
processes should also run faster as well. Not to mention, you can take
advantage of features not found in 7.x versions such as function based
indexes, table & index partitioning, and others. Your legacy systems
might not take advantage of these new features right away, but over
time, you will.
